Transaction 8e4bc1624a148aa58a577dae416bd9c40c1ec07f4c558cb325ffe82b9878008b
4 Input
2 Outputs
- 8e4bc1624a148aa58a577dae416bd9c40c1ec07f4c558cb325ffe82b9878008b:0
- 8e4bc1624a148aa58a577dae416bd9c40c1ec07f4c558cb325ffe82b9878008b:1
value 934556
address 1Eeyd3NJT1j5aF1cv14jPRAAgdstV8r8Gs
value 15618000
address 1GWbkmibk9pHW9qSc9QTshM2Se6zKv3tR4